    GlossaryChromatin Immunoprecipitation

    method to study protein-DNA interactions using specific antibodies

    Chromatin Immunoprecipitation (ChIP) is a laboratory technique used to investigate the interaction between proteins and DNA within the cell. By using specific antibodies to target and isolate a protein of interest, researchers can identify the DNA sequences that are bound by this protein, providing insights into gene regulation and epigenetic mechanisms.
